Dive 18/18 of the 2017 Red Sea liveaboard on Blue Melody.
25°28.194'N 34°40.974'E
http://maps.google.com/maps?q=25.46991%2C34.68291
The very last dive of the entire trip. Managed to do 18 dives total, out of 19 offered.
I only skipped the night dive on 17th to Orabi.
I took my camera for this dive, Tomi did not take anything.
I had fisheye inside dome and one flash.
Me and Tomi went to East around the reef corner and then north, outside of the bay where the reef opened to the sea. We stayed at 15 meters on our way out then turned back at 22 min, and came back at shallower depth about 12-10 meters.
Around the corner there was much better visibility and very sunny. There was a small swell from the big waves above, rocking us back and forth but nothing too disturbing. There were sandy patches, and then small coral bommies, occational growing pinnacles and some table corals. Not that much fish, but quite pretty scenery. Saw some linofishes, a blue spotted ray, one small anemone, the usual little fishes.
On coming back around the corner some curious trumptet fishes. Ended the dive next to the boat at 5 meters, did the safety stop at the reef, then back t the boat.
